In the heart of California's wine country, the Old Faithful Geyser of California is one of only three in the world. Visit and see the steam and boiling water erupt about every half hour. While you are waiting, enjoy the petting-zoo featuring Tennessee Fainting Goats, Jacob's Four-Horn Sheep and Guard Llamas. Bring a picnic lunch, there is plenty of room on the grounds and facilities for an enjoyable family outing. The Kruse Rhododendron State Reserve, located near Healdsburg, began as an ranch for the Kruse family in 1880. The land was donated to the state in 1933. Visitors today enjoy the five miles of hiking trails through the 317 acres of second-growth redwood, grand fir and Douglas fir forests and clusters of rhododendrons. During May, hikers enjoy the brilliant pink rhododendron blossoms.
The Department of Parks and Recreation maintain the reserve to ensure the regenerating forest is not overwhelming the rhododendrons. Salt Point State Park is located near Healdsburg in California's wine country. The park encompasses 6,000 acres along the coast include 20 miles of hiking, biking and horseback riding trails. The sandy beaches are a great place to relax or fish from. Scuba diving is another favorite activity in the park. Bring your camera to capture the tafoni, where the water crystallizes into the honeycomb like crevices, along the rocky coast line.
During the 1800s, sandstone from Salt Point was used to create the streets and buildings in San Francisco. Stroll to Gerstle Cove to see the eyebolts left in the rocks. Ships would anchor to the rocks while loading slabs of sandstone onboard. Enjoy the scenic beauty of the steep ocean cliffs and shallow tide pools.
